EZGO RXV 2010, PowerWise won't charge new batteries
I have a 2010 48 volt RXV that I put in storage for three years.
Last week, I took it out of storage and replaced the batteries with four brand new US Battery US12VRX. I drove the car for four days, distances approximately 0.5 miles each time and plugged in my PowerWise QE charger after each use. On the fifth morning I woke up and discovered that the cart had not charged overnight and the charger was flashing two red pulse followed by a pause -- indicating either a low or high voltage. I used a volt meter to measure the voltage of each battery (12.1 volts) and of the whole circuit (approx 48 volts). Next, I used the meter to check the receptacle and also saw 48 volts. Next, thinking my charger was faulty I connected a completely different charger to the receptacle and saw the same error code (two red flashes). Suspecting a problem with the receptacle, I connected a 20amp icon charger directly to the positive and negative nodes for the circuit and finally saw the batteries start to charge. Based on that I suspected that there was a problem with the charger receptacle so I purchased two replacements from Amazon (just in case): https://www.amazon.com/dp/B074QKMRWQ...roduct_details I tried both receptacles and after each installation I continued to see the same fault code on my charger. I'm at a loss about what to look at next because I've tested the batteries, charger and replaced the receptacle port -- all appear to be fine. Does anyone else have any ideas about what I should try? |
